Output e18365377de94a48a0ebc1ad88ab033255303fefce23de97ddf949f96f080255:32

value
405998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 414281348598e0cb85d985e234e35911d2462a07 OP_EQUAL
address
37e5WqioQ7Xtpx8UNLgpZ6nfGLrFWUSUzQ
transaction
e18365377de94a48a0ebc1ad88ab033255303fefce23de97ddf949f96f080255
spent
true